Old friendA Poem by anartaoHello old friend, I see you there standing quiet by the end of the bed A face once feared now welcome sight, open arms where once there lay dread
I have waited for you for many a month as my eyes fade, and my body it aches This tenuous link, that I once held so tight, with your hands I will hopefully break
I long to slough off this tattered garment with its brittle frame of bones, and cast off this mantle of weariness and these years that weigh like stones
I long to see those who reside in my heart, those who've travelled before by your side, those who have left me behind in this world like a pool that remains from the tide
Come forward brother, and please take my hand, for the drum beats inside's growing quiet, and let us go forward to dance on the wind, and once more become one with the light © 2013 anartao |
